Bronchoalveolar Lavage Fluid Sampling

Check if the same lab product or an alternative is used in the 5 most similar protocols
BAL fluid samples were collected by wedging a 3.8 mm flexible bronchoscope (aScope 3, Ambu) into a subsegmental bronchus of an injured or control lung. Sterile normal saline (5 mL) was injected, aspirated, and collected in a sterile specimen trap (Busse Hospital Disposables). Gross images of BAL fluid samples were acquired throughout 36 h of cross-circulation using an interchangeable lens digital camera (Sony). The pH of BAL fluid samples was measured with a glass double junction microelectrode (Fisher Scientific). BAL fluid samples were centrifuged at 2164 × g for 10 min at 4 °C. Snap-frozen supernatants were stored at –80 °C until further processing.

Assessing Lung Injury from Gastric Aspiration

Check if the same lab product or an alternative is used in the 5 most similar protocols
Following unilateral bronchoscopic delivery of standardized gastric contents into donor lungs, donor vitals and ventilator settings were continuously recorded. Chest X-rays, airway bronchoscopic images, and hemogases were obtained at baseline and every 2 h for 6 h. Donor blood samples were collected at baseline and 6 h after gastric aspiration to assess serum levels of inflammatory markers (GM-CSF, IFNγ, IL-1α, IL-1β, IL-1rα, IL-2, IL-4, IL-6, IL-8, IL-10, IL-12, IL-18, P-Selectin, and TNFα) by multiplex array analysis (Eve Technologies) and hemolytic markers (D-dimer, fibrinogen, and plasma free hemoglobin) by commercially available enzyme-linked immunosorbant assays (ELISAs). A list of the ELISA kits used is provided in Supplementary Table 11. BAL fluid samples were collected from injured and control lungs at baseline and 6 h after gastric aspiration to assess the airway response to gastric aspiration. Inflammatory markers (GM-CSF, IFNγ, IL-1α, IL-1β, IL-1rα, IL-2, IL-4 IL-6, IL-8, IL-10, IL-12, IL-18, and TNFα) in BAL fluid samples were quantified by multiplex array analysis (Eve Technologies), M30 by commercially available ELISA, and cellular contents in BAL fluid were analyzed by Kwik-Diff staining or periodic acid-Schiff staining. Gross images of injured lungs were obtained prior to explant using an interchangeable lens digital camera (Sony).
